Solr安装异常:SolrException: Error loading class 'solr.VelocityResponseWriter'
解决方法安装Solr过程出现错误,报异常
org.apache.solr.common.SolrException: Error loading class 'solr.VelocityResponseWriter' ,
解决方法:
找到$solr_home\conf\solrconfig.xml,把中间(Solr 3.5.0 1554行)
<queryResponseWriter name="velocity" class="solr.VelocityResponseWriter" enable="${solr.velocity.enabled:true}"/>注释或者disabled - enable:false即可。
在本段之前,solrconfig.xml中就有写:
- <!--
- Custom response writers can be declared as needed...
- -->
- <!-- The solr.velocity.enabled flag is used by Solr's test cases so that this response writer is not
- loaded (causing an error if contrib/velocity has not been built fully) -->
- <queryResponseWriter name="velocity" class="solr.VelocityResponseWriter" enable="${solr.velocity.enabled:false}"/>
本文出自 “IcerSummer” 博客,请务必保留此出处http://icersummer.blog.51cto.com/1049418/827989
转自:http://icersummer.blog.51cto.com/1049418/827989
2019-03-27 00:23
知识点
相关教程
更多solr error logs org.apache.solr.common.SolrException: ERROR: [doc=17] unknown field alias
在solr中 添加新的索引词语时,报如标题所示错误,指定是插入的字段没有在solr索引字段里 可以修改 solr安装目录/solr/conf 目录下的schema.xml 在此xml文件内加入所需字段即可,格式如下 <field name="alias" type="text_general" indexed="true" stor
solr 4.4 Error filterStart 问题
纠结了很久的问题,https://wiki.apache.org/solr/SolrLogging#Using_the_example_logging_setup_in_containers_other_than_Jetty 查到了。 差不多就是说解决方案: 1 把solr/example/lib/ext 下面的jar 都复制到 tomcat/lib 目录下面 2 把solr/example/
solr 搭建中的一个小问题
我用tomcat 7.0加solr3.5 tomcat启动时报org.apache.solr.common.SolrException: Error loading class 'solr.VelocityResponseWriter' , 这时找到solr\home\conf\solrconfig.xml,把中间<queryResponseWriter name="velocit
maven项目使用SOLR时报 previously initiated loading for a different type with name "javax/servlet/http/HttpServletRequest" 错的解决方法
环境:Apache solr4.8,maven3,IntellijIDEA 想在项目中使用solr 在pom.xml文件中添加了solr的依赖 solr-core,solrj 和solr-dataimporthandler 在使用tomcat6插件启动项目的时候报错: 八月 22, 2014 3:43:46 下午 org.apache.catalina.core.StandardWrapperVa
org.apache.solr.common.SolrException: No such core: core0
删除掉E:/Java Projects/fulltextsearch/WebRoot/WEB-INF/solr/multicore/data0/index下所有索引相关的文件之后,再次运行程序报: 2011-5-20 15:17:01 org.apache.solr.common.SolrException log 严重: java.lang.RuntimeException: java.io.F
solr搜索异常
2012-12-22 9:18:06 org.apache.solr.common.SolrException log 严重: org.apache.solr.common.SolrException: ERROR: [doc=[B@e046ccf] unknown field 'geo_name' at org.apache.solr.update.DocumentBuilder.toDocum
[solr]solr的安装
solr是什么? 翻译: SolrTMis the popular, blazing fast open source enterprise search platform from the Apache LuceneTMproject. Its major features include powerful full-text search, hit highlighting, faceted
eclipse里报:An internal error occurred during:
eclipse里报:An internal error occurred during: Building workspace. Java heap space的解决方法
Solr安装(1)
Solr是一个基于Lucene java库的企业级搜索服务器,本文记录了solr的安装过程,版本为最新的1.4.1。 1) 下载 从solr的官网http://lucene.apache.org/solr/找到最新的版本1.4.1. 解开下载的apache-solr-1.4.1.zip或apache-solr-1.4.1.tgz文件到apache-solr-1
solr安装
Windowssolr(tomcat) 1.1.安装步骤 1.1.1准备工作 1.服务器:apache-tomcat-7.0.40压缩版,http://localhost:8080/安装是否成功; 2.Solr版本:solr4.3http://mirror.bjtu.edu.cn/apache/lucene/solr/4.3.0/ 3.我的tomcat安装路径为E:\apache-tomcat-
Hadoop编译WordCount程序:class file for org.apache.commons.cli.Options no
Hadoop问题:编译WordCount程序报错:class file for org.apache.commons.cli.Optio 第一次编译Hadoop的程序,将安装程序自带的WordCount程序拿出来编译执行,编译时遇到如下错误: Ubuntu@ubuntu:~/dev/wordcount$ javac -classpath /home/ubuntu/hadoop-1.0.4/hado
solr+hadoop版本不一致导致的异常
Caused by: com.google.protobuf.InvalidProtocolBufferException: Protocol message contained an invalid tag (zero). at com.google.protobuf.InvalidProtocolBufferException.invalidTag(InvalidProtocolBufferE
安装solr
1. 安装tomcat solr是j2ee应用程序,首先需要安装j2ee容器,这里选用tomcat6。需要安装openjdk1.7.0和tomcat6。 # yum install -y java-1.7.0-openjdk java-1.7.0-openjdk-devel # yum install -y tomcat6 # service tomcat6 restart 编辑 /etc/tom
安装solr
转载请注明出处:http://lucien-zzy.iteye.com/blog/2002087 这篇文章讲解了哪儿些功能的实现呢? 第一:能通过http://localhost:7080/solr/ 正常访问solr,介绍三种solr/home的配置方式(这里用JNDI方式实现)分别为:基于JNDI、基于当前路径、基于环境变量的方式 第二:实现三种中文分词器的安装,包括:smartcn 分词器、
ubuntu下安装和配置solr
其实安装solr 还是蛮简单的 但是第一次弄 被 tomcat的错误提示搞得头大! 菜鸟 安装tomcat方法相信你懂的 sudu apt-get install tomcat6 .。。。 相信一定是通顺的 启动tomcat # /ect/init.d/tomcat6 start 下载最新的solr 人人的源 比较给力 http://labs.renren.com/apache-mirror//l
最新教程
更多java线程状态详解(6种)
java线程类为:java.lang.Thread,其实现java.lang.Runnable接口。 线程在运行过程中有6种状态,分别如下: NEW:初始状态,线程被构建,但是还没有调用start()方法 RUNNABLE:运行状态,Java线程将操作系统中的就绪和运行两种状态统称为“运行状态” BLOCK:阻塞状态,表示线程阻塞
redis从库只读设置-redis集群管理
默认情况下redis数据库充当slave角色时是只读的不能进行写操作,如果写入,会提示以下错误:READONLY You can't write against a read only slave. 127.0.0.1:6382> set k3 111 (error) READONLY You can't write against a read only slave. 如果你要开启从库
Netty环境配置
netty是一个java事件驱动的网络通信框架,也就是一个jar包,只要在项目里引用即可。
Netty基于流的传输处理
在TCP/IP的基于流的传输中,接收的数据被存储到套接字接收缓冲器中。不幸的是,基于流的传输的缓冲器不是分组的队列,而是字节的队列。 这意味着,即使将两个消息作为两个独立的数据包发送,操作系统也不会将它们视为两个消息,而只是一组字节(有点悲剧)。 因此,不能保证读的是您在远程定入的行数据
Netty入门实例-使用POJO代替ByteBuf
使用TIME协议的客户端和服务器示例,让它们使用POJO来代替原来的ByteBuf。
Netty入门实例-时间服务器
Netty中服务器和客户端之间最大的和唯一的区别是使用了不同的Bootstrap和Channel实现
Netty入门实例-编写服务器端程序
channelRead()处理程序方法实现如下
Netty开发环境配置
最新版本的Netty 4.x和JDK 1.6及更高版本
电商平台数据库设计
电商平台数据库表设计:商品分类表、商品信息表、品牌表、商品属性表、商品属性扩展表、规格表、规格扩展表
HttpClient 上传文件
我们使用MultipartEntityBuilder创建一个HttpEntity。 当创建构建器时,添加一个二进制体 - 包含将要上传的文件以及一个文本正文。 接下来,使用RequestBuilder创建一个HTTP请求,并分配先前创建的HttpEntity。
MongoDB常用命令
查看当前使用的数据库 > db test 切换数据库 > use foobar switched to db foobar 插入文档 > post={"title":"领悟书生","content":"这是一个分享教程的网站","date":new
快速了解MongoDB【基本概念与体系结构】
什么是MongoDB MongoDB is a general purpose, document-based, distributed database built for modern application developers and for the cloud era. MongoDB是一个基于分布式文件存储的数据库。由C++语言编写。旨在为WEB应用提供可扩展的高性能数据存储解决方案。
windows系统安装MongoDB
安装 下载MongoDB的安装包:mongodb-win32-x86_64-2008plus-ssl-3.2.10-signed.msi,按照提示步骤安装即可。 安装完成后,软件会安装在C:\Program Files\MongoDB 目录中 我们要启动的服务程序就是C:\Program Files\MongoDB\Server\3.2\bin目录下的mongod.exe,为了方便我们每次启动,我
Spring boot整合MyBatis-Plus 之二:增删改查
基于上一篇springboot整合MyBatis-Plus之后,实现简单的增删改查 创建实体类 添加表注解TableName和主键注解TableId import com.baomidou.mybatisplus.annotations.TableId; import com.baomidou.mybatisplus.annotations.TableName; import com.baom
分布式ID生成器【snowflake雪花算法】
基于snowflake雪花算法分布式ID生成器 snowflake雪花算法分布式ID生成器几大特点: 41bit的时间戳可以支持该算法使用到2082年 10bit的工作机器id可以支持1024台机器 序列号支持1毫秒产生4096个自增序列id 整体上按照时间自增排序 整个分布式系统内不会产生ID碰撞 每秒能够产生26万ID左右 Twitter的 Snowflake分布式ID生成器的JAVA实现方案